In that case you'll have to provide much more details. Boot log probably using netconsole. Check config differences. I suggested large-memory lilo option because your lilo.conf didn't have it and 2.6.30 is known to outgrow default lilo assumptions. So it wasn't your case, it has to be in config change or in something failing during boot. Examine boot log (you can try adding vga=ask and choosing the largest resolution offered, and also try loglevel=4 or loglevel=5 this will reduce printk noise printed on the console) and config changes.
